Immediate Code Review – Is it Scam? – Crypto exchange
In the rapidly evolving world of cryptocurrency exchanges, ensuring the security and functionality of the underlying code is of utmost importance. Code review plays a crucial role in this process, as it helps identify and fix vulnerabilities, improve system performance, and ensure compliance with industry standards. One relatively new approach to code review is immediate code review, which aims to expedite the review process and provide faster feedback. However, as with any new concept, there are concerns about the potential for scams and fraudulent activities. In this article, we will explore the concept of immediate code review, evaluate the scam concern surrounding it, and provide guidance on how to evaluate the legitimacy of a crypto exchange.
II. Understanding Immediate Code Review
Immediate code review is a process where code changes are reviewed and approved in real-time, allowing developers to receive immediate feedback. Unlike traditional code review processes that may involve scheduled meetings or lengthy review cycles, immediate code review aims to streamline the process and facilitate faster iterations. This approach can be particularly beneficial in the fast-paced world of cryptocurrency exchanges, where quick response times are crucial.
Immediate code review differs from traditional code review processes in several ways. First, it focuses on real-time collaboration, enabling developers to address issues promptly. Second, it often involves automated tools and systems that provide instant feedback on code quality and security. Finally, immediate code review emphasizes continuous integration and deployment, allowing developers to quickly incorporate changes and updates into the live system.
The benefits of immediate code review are numerous. It allows for faster development cycles, reducing the time it takes to implement and test new features or bug fixes. It also facilitates better collaboration between developers, as they can address issues and provide feedback in real-time. Additionally, immediate code review helps maintain code quality and security by catching potential vulnerabilities early on. Overall, immediate code review can lead to more efficient development processes and improved system performance.
III. The Scam Concern
Despite the potential benefits of immediate code review, there are concerns about scams and fraudulent activities in the crypto exchange industry. The anonymity and decentralized nature of cryptocurrencies make them an attractive target for scammers, and crypto exchanges are no exception. Common scams in the crypto exchange industry include exit scams, where the exchange operators disappear with users' funds, and pump and dump schemes, where the value of a particular cryptocurrency is artificially inflated and then dumped.
Immediate code review can be vulnerable to scams due to its fast-paced nature. Scammers may take advantage of the urgency and lack of thorough analysis to introduce malicious code or hide vulnerabilities. Additionally, the difficulty in verifying the expertise of code reviewers can also make immediate code review susceptible to scams. It is crucial for users and investors to exercise caution and conduct proper due diligence when evaluating a crypto exchange.
IV. Evaluating the Legitimacy of a Crypto Exchange
To mitigate the risk of falling victim to scams, it is essential to thoroughly evaluate the legitimacy of a crypto exchange. Here are some key steps to consider:
Research the background and reputation of the exchange: Look for information about the exchange's founders, team members, and their previous experience in the crypto industry. Check for any past controversies or negative feedback.
Check for proper licensing and regulatory compliance: Ensure that the exchange is registered with relevant regulatory authorities and complies with applicable laws and regulations. This helps ensure the exchange operates within a legal framework and is subject to oversight.
Read user reviews and feedback: Look for feedback from other users and investors who have used the exchange. Pay attention to any reports of security breaches, withdrawal issues, or suspicious activities. Be cautious if there are numerous negative reviews or unresolved complaints.
By conducting thorough research and due diligence, users can make informed decisions and reduce the risk of falling victim to scams or fraudulent activities.
V. Importance of Code Review in Crypto Exchanges
Code review is a critical aspect of ensuring the security and functionality of a crypto exchange. Here are some key reasons why code review is important:
Enhancing security measures and preventing vulnerabilities: Code review helps identify and fix potential security vulnerabilities in the exchange's codebase. By catching these issues early on, exchanges can prevent security breaches and protect users' funds.
Ensuring compliance with industry standards and best practices: Code review helps ensure that the exchange's code adheres to industry standards and best practices. This includes following secure coding guidelines, implementing proper authentication and authorization mechanisms, and using encryption where necessary.
Improving overall system functionality and performance: Code review can help identify and address performance bottlenecks, scalability issues, or other technical limitations. By optimizing the codebase and implementing efficient algorithms, exchanges can provide a smoother and more reliable trading experience for users.
By prioritizing code review, crypto exchanges can build robust and secure platforms that inspire trust and confidence among users and investors.
VI. Risks Associated with Immediate Code Review
While immediate code review offers benefits in terms of speed and efficiency, it also comes with certain risks. Here are some potential risks associated with immediate code review:
Lack of thorough analysis and understanding of the code: Due to the fast-paced nature of immediate code review, there may be a risk of overlooking critical vulnerabilities or bugs. Without sufficient time for in-depth analysis, reviewers may miss potential issues that could pose a significant risk to the exchange and its users.
Potential for overlooking critical vulnerabilities or bugs: In the rush to provide immediate feedback, reviewers may inadvertently miss critical vulnerabilities or bugs in the code. This can result in the release of insecure or faulty software, putting users' funds and personal information at risk.
Difficulty in verifying the expertise of reviewers: Immediate code review often involves collaboration with external code reviewers or consultants. Verifying the qualifications and experience of these reviewers can be challenging, as there may not be a standardized process for evaluating their expertise. This can lead to a lack of trust and confidence in the review process.
To mitigate these risks, it is essential to establish a standardized process for immediate code review and ensure that reviewers have the necessary expertise and qualifications.
VII. Combating Scams through Proper Due Diligence
To combat scams and fraudulent activities in the crypto exchange industry, it is crucial to exercise proper due diligence. Here are some steps that can help:
Conduct comprehensive background checks on the exchange team: Research the backgrounds of the founders and team members. Look for their previous experience in the crypto industry and any past controversies or scams they may have been involved in.
Verify the qualifications and experience of code reviewers: If the exchange claims to use immediate code review, ensure that the code reviewers have the necessary expertise and qualifications. Look for certifications or professional affiliations that demonstrate their competence in code review and security analysis.
Utilize external security audits and penetration testing: Consider engaging third-party security firms to conduct independent audits and penetration testing of the exchange's codebase. This can provide an additional layer of assurance and help identify any vulnerabilities or weaknesses that may have been missed during the immediate code review process.
By following these steps, users can make more informed decisions and reduce the risk of falling victim to scams or fraudulent activities.
VIII. Best Practices for Immediate Code Review
To ensure the effectiveness and integrity of immediate code review, it is essential to follow best practices. Here are some key best practices to consider:
Establish a standardized process for immediate code review: Define clear guidelines and expectations for the code review process, including roles and responsibilities, review criteria, and documentation requirements. This helps ensure consistency and accountability in the review process.
Implement thorough documentation and logging: Maintain detailed documentation of the code review process, including the issues identified, actions taken, and any changes made to the codebase. This documentation serves as a historical record and can be valuable for future reference or audits.
Regularly update and maintain code review policies: As the crypto exchange evolves and new security threats emerge, it is important to regularly review and update the code review policies and procedures. This helps ensure that the review process remains effective and aligned with the latest industry standards and best practices.
By following these best practices, exchanges can enhance the integrity and effectiveness of their immediate code review processes.
IX. The Role of Regulatory Authorities
Regulatory authorities play a crucial role in the crypto exchange industry, helping combat scams and fraudulent activities. Here are some key aspects of their role:
Regulatory frameworks and guidelines for crypto exchanges: Regulatory authorities establish and enforce frameworks and guidelines that govern the operation of crypto exchanges. These frameworks often include requirements for security measures, customer protection, and anti-money laundering (AML) compliance.
Collaboration with regulatory authorities to combat scams: Crypto exchanges are required to collaborate with regulatory authorities to ensure compliance with applicable laws and regulations. This includes providing regular reports, conducting audits, and participating in investigations when necessary.
Reporting suspicious activities to authorities: Exchanges are obligated to report any suspicious activities or transactions that may indicate money laundering, fraud, or other illegal activities. By reporting such activities, exchanges contribute to the overall effort to combat scams and protect users.
Regulatory authorities provide an additional layer of oversight and accountability in the crypto exchange industry, helping to maintain trust and confidence among users and investors.
Code review is a critical aspect of ensuring the security, functionality, and integrity of crypto exchanges. While immediate code review offers benefits in terms of speed and efficiency, it is important to exercise caution and conduct proper due diligence to mitigate the risk of scams and fraudulent activities. By evaluating the legitimacy of a crypto exchange, prioritizing code review, and following best practices, users can make more informed decisions and reduce the risk of falling victim to scams. Additionally, regulatory authorities play a crucial role in maintaining trust and confidence in the crypto exchange industry. By staying informed and vigilant, users can navigate the crypto exchange landscape with greater confidence and security.